Exactly what is a Robotic Vacuum Cleaner?

A robotic vacuum cleaner is an autonomous device created to clean floors without direct human control. These compact, generally disc-shaped machines navigate your living area using a combination of sensors, mapping innovation, and algorithms. They are engineered to draw up dust, dirt, pet hair, and particles from numerous floor surface areas like wood, tile, and carpets.

Robovacs operate on rechargeable batteries and normally included a charging dock. As soon as their battery is low or cleaning is complete (depending upon the design and settings), they automatically return to their charging dock. Numerous modern robovacs are also Wi-Fi enabled, enabling users to control them from another location by means of smart device apps. This connectivity opens up a world of functions like scheduling cleaning sessions, setting virtual borders, and even keeping track of cleaning development from afar.

Unpacking the Technology: How Robovacs Navigate and Clean

The intelligence of a robovac depends on its advanced technology that enables it to navigate and clean efficiently. Here are some crucial elements and technologies powering these cleaning robotics:

  • Navigation Systems: Robovacs employ various navigation approaches to map and traverse your home.

    • Random Bounce: Simpler and frequently older models use a random bounce method. They relocate an approximately straight line till they come across a challenge, then change direction. While less efficient, they eventually cover most areas.
    • Gyro Navigation: These robovacs utilize gyroscopes to maintain a straight cleaning path and remember where they have cleaned. This is more organized than random bounce.
    • Camera-Based SLAM (Simultaneous Localization and Mapping): More advanced models utilize video cameras to "see" their surroundings. SLAM technology enables them to develop a detailed map of your home in real-time, making it possible for more effective and methodical navigation.
    • LiDAR (Light Detection and Ranging): Similar to self-driving cars, some premium robovacs utilize LiDAR. This technology releases laser pulses to determine ranges and produce extremely precise maps, even in low-light conditions.
  • Sensors: A variety of sensors are essential for robovac operation:

    • Bump Sensors: Detect crashes with walls and furnishings, prompting the robovac to change instructions.
    • Cliff Sensors: Prevent the robovac from dropping stairs or ledges.
    • Wall Follow Sensors: Enable the robovac to tidy edges and baseboards effectively.
    • Dirt Detect Sensors: Some robovacs have sensing units that discover areas with greater concentrations of dirt, prompting them to focus cleaning on those areas.
  • Cleaning Mechanisms: Robovacs utilize a mix of brushes and suction to tidy:

    • Side Brushes: Rotate outwards to sweep debris from edges and corners into the path of the primary brush.
    • Main Brush Rollers: Typically situated underneath the robovac, these rollers upset carpets and sweep debris towards the suction nozzle. Some models have actually brush rollers created for specific floor types (e.g., softer brushes for hardwood, stiffer for carpets).
    • Suction: A motor creates suction to pull particles into the dustbin. Suction power varies in between designs.
  • Smart Features and Connectivity: Modern robovacs typically boast smart features:

    • App Control: Enables remote control, scheduling, zone cleaning, virtual borders, and cleaning history viewing.
    • Voice Control Integration: Compatibility with voice assistants like Amazon Alexa or Google Assistant for hands-free control.
    • Mapping and Zone Cleaning: Allows users to define particular areas for cleaning or to develop "no-go zones" via the app.
    • Multi-Floor Mapping: Advanced robovacs can save maps of numerous floorings, perfect for multi-story homes.

The Perks of Owning a Robovac Hoover

The appeal of robovac hoovers is indisputable. They provide numerous advantages that add to a cleaner and easier lifestyle:

  • Hands-Free Cleaning: The most significant advantage is automation. Robovacs tidy floors individually, maximizing your time for other tasks or leisure activities.
  • Consistent Cleaning: Robovacs can be arranged to clean regularly, guaranteeing a consistent level of cleanliness in your home, even if you don't have time for day-to-day manual vacuuming.
  • Reach Under Furniture: Their low profile enables them to clean up under beds, sofas, and other furniture where conventional vacuums struggle to reach.
  • Perfect for Pet Owners: Robovacs are exceptional at selecting up pet hair, a continuous challenge for numerous households with furry companions. Regular robovac cleaning can significantly minimize pet hair build-up.
  • Benefit for Busy Individuals and Families: For busy professionals, parents, or anyone who values time, robovacs offer a considerable time-saving solution for floor cleaning.
  • Improved Air Quality (with HEPA Filters): Many robovacs come equipped with HEPA filters, which trap fine dust particles, irritants, and pet dander, contributing to enhanced indoor air quality, particularly useful for allergy patients.

Selecting the Right Robovac for Your Needs

With a broad range of robovac models readily available, choosing the ideal one can seem complicated. Consider these factors when making your option:

  • Home Size and Layout: Larger homes or homes with multiple spaces may take advantage of robovacs with advanced mapping and longer battery life. Complex designs with many challenges might require models with exceptional navigation.
  • Floor Types: Assess the dominant floor types in your home. Some robovacs are much better matched for wood floors, while others excel on carpets. Search for designs with features optimized for your particular floor types.
  • Pet Ownership: If you have pets, prioritize robovacs with strong suction, tangle-free brush rollers developed for pet hair, and bigger dustbins.
  • Budget plan: Robovacs vary in price from budget-friendly to high-end. Identify your budget plan and prioritize functions that are essential to you within that range.
  • Preferred Features: Consider which features are must-haves for you. Do you require app control, voice integration, mapping, zone cleaning, or multi-floor mapping?
  • Noise Level: Robovacs differ in noise output. If sound sensitivity is a concern, search for models advertised as quieter.
  • Dustbin Capacity: Larger dustbins need less regular emptying, which can be hassle-free, especially for larger homes or homes with family pets.

Keeping Your Robovac for Longevity

To ensure your robovac hoover continues to perform efficiently and lasts for several years to come, routine upkeep is essential:

  • Empty the Dustbin Regularly: This is vital. A complete dustbin lowers suction power and cleaning effectiveness. Empty it after each cleaning cycle or as needed.
  • Tidy the Brushes: Pet hair and debris can tangle in the brushes. Routinely remove and clean the main brush roller and side brushes.
  • Clean the Sensors: Wipe the sensing units, particularly cliff sensors and wall follow sensors, with a soft, dry cloth to ensure they function correctly.
  • Change Filters: HEPA filters need to be replaced periodically according to the producer's recommendations to maintain optimum air purification.
  • Check and Clean Wheels: Ensure the wheels are devoid of particles and turn efficiently.
  • Software application Updates: If your robovac has Wi-Fi connection, guarantee you set up any readily available software updates to benefit from performance improvements and brand-new functions.

Often Asked Questions (FAQs) about Robovac Hoovers

Q1: Are robovacs as effective as regular vacuum cleaners?A1: While robovacs have actually become increasingly effective, the majority of are not as effective as full-sized upright vacuums. They are created for everyday maintenance cleaning and are outstanding at selecting up daily dust, dirt, and pet hair. For deep cleaning or extremely heavily soiled areas, a traditional vacuum may still be required.

Q2: Can robovacs tidy carpets effectively?A2: Yes, lots of robovacs are created to clean carpets. Try to find designs with functions like strong suction, brush rollers designed for carpets, and adjustable suction levels. However, for thick stack carpets, higher-end designs might be required for optimal cleaning.

Q3: Do robovacs work well with pet hair?A3: Yes, robovacs are usually very reliable at selecting up pet hair. Look for designs particularly marketed as pet-friendly, often including tangle-free brush rollers and strong suction. Regular robovac cleaning can substantially lower pet hair accumulation.

Q4: How long do robovac batteries last?A4: Battery life varies depending upon the model and cleaning mode. Most robovacs provide battery life varying from 60 to 120 minutes on a single charge. Some high-end designs can run for even longer.

Q5: Can robovacs harm furniture?A5: Robovacs are designed to navigate around furniture utilizing bump sensors. While they might gently run into furnishings, they are not designed to trigger damage. Nevertheless, it's advisable to clear any loose or fragile items from the floor before running a robovac.

Q6: How frequently should I run my robovac?A6: For ideal tidiness, running your robovac day-to-day or every other day is advised, especially in homes with pets or high traffic. You can arrange cleaning sessions via the app for automated cleaning.

Q7: Do robovacs operate in the dark?A7: Models with LiDAR navigation work effectively in the dark as they utilize lasers for mapping. Camera-based SLAM models might perform less efficiently in extremely dark environments. Random bounce and gyro navigation models typically function well in a lot of lighting conditions as they depend on physical sensing units.

Q8: What happens if my robovac gets stuck?A8: Most modern-day robovacs are developed to avoid getting stuck. Nevertheless, if they do get stuck, they frequently stop and release a mistake notice (often via the app). You'll require to manually totally free it. Clearing mess and wires from the floor can minimize the chances of getting stuck.

Q9: Can robovacs climb up over limits?A9: Most robovacs can climb over limits, however the height they can manage differs. Usually, they can deal with thresholds as much as 0.5-0.75 inches. Inspect the manufacturer's specs for the threshold climbing capability of a specific design.

Q10: Are robovacs loud?A10: Robovac sound levels differ depending upon the design and suction power. Normally, they are quieter than conventional vacuum, however they still produce some sound. Try to find designs promoted as "peaceful operation" if sound is a concern.
